13th STREET WINERY CLASSIC SERIES CABERNET MERLOT 2018, VQA Niagara Peninsula, Ontario, Canada

29 Thursday Apr 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in 13th Street Winery, Best Buys, Canadian Wines, Recommended, Red Wines, Winery Review Series

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$19.95
Grape: 67% Cabernet Sauvignon, 33% Merlot
Category: White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: Canada
Region: Niagara Peninsula, Ontario
Format: 750 mL
Producer: 13th Street Winery
Alcohol:  12.5% Alcohol/Vol.

Smooth easy everyday drinking wine. Score: 88/100

Tasting Note: Light to medium ruby in colour with good acidity, a medium+ intense nose, soft tannin & a good length on the finish. This wine features: Black cherry, plum, red & black currants, sweet toasted oak, white pepper & vanilla.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Wine was aged both in stainless steel & oak barrels. Also, please see my review on the 2019 vintage.

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 3-4 years on its own or pair it with Roast Beef with Plum Pudding

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: April 28, 2021

LCBO: 56598

13th STREET WINERY CABERNET/MERLOT CLASSIC SERIES 2019, VQA Creek Shores, Niagara Region, Ontario, Canada

25 Sunday Apr 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in 13th Street Winery, Best Buys, Canadian Wines, Non LCBO Wine, Recommended, Red Wines, Winery Review Series

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$21.95
Grape: 53% Cabernet Sauvignon, 47% Merlot
Category: White Wine
Location: Winery (See Interesting Point below)
Country: Canada
Region: Creek Shores, Niagara Region, Ontario
Format: 750 mL
Producer: 13th Street Winery
Alcohol:  13.0% Alcohol/Vol.

This delicious wine is 100%-barrel fermented & has a burst of fruit expression then it’s rounded out by the Merlot. Score: 90/100

Tasting Note: Light to medium ruby in colour with good acidity, a medium+ intense nose, medium tannin & a long length on the finish. This wine features: Black cherry, mulberry, plum, pomegranate, sweet toast, malt chocolate, white pepper & vanilla.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: The 2019 vintage is currently available only at the winery, but the LCBO still carries the 2018 at $19.95

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 5-7 years on its own or pair it with grilled T-Bone steak

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: April 24, 2021

LCBO: 56598

SEÑARÍO DE LA ANTIGUA FINCA CABANELA MENĆIA 2015, DO Castilla y León, Spain

20 Tuesday Apr 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Best Buys, Recommended, Red Wines

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$14.95
Grape: Menćia
Category: Red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: Spain
Region: Castilla y León
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Bodegas Seńorío de la Antigua
Alcohol:  13.5% Alcohol/Vol.

Not complex but very flavourful, easy drinking, not flat or sweet, plus it’s good value for your money. Score: 88/100

Tasting Note: Medium dark ruby in colour with good acidity, a medium+ intense nose, smooth tannin & an average length on the finish. This wine features: Blackberry, blackcurrants, plum, tamarind, mushrooms & white pepper.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Lightly chill to about 17 C in order to give this wine more freshness

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 3-4 years on its own or pair it with Carne Asada

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: April 19, 2021

LCBO: 481549

NIAGARA COLLEGE TEACHING WINERY BALANCE SEMILLON-SAUVIGNON BLANC 2017, VQA Lincoln Lakeshore, Niagara Region, Ontario, Canada

12 Monday Apr 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Best Buys, Canadian Wines, Niagara College Teaching Winery, Non LCBO Wine, Recommended, White Wines, Winery Review Series

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$16.95
Grape: 83% Semillon, 17% Sauvignon Blanc
Category: White Wine
Location: Winery
Country: Canada
Region: Lincoln Lakeshore, Niagara Region, Ontario
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Niagara College Teaching Winery
Alcohol:  13.0% Alcohol/Vol.

This wine gives you a nice balance between sour & tart flavours. Score: 88/100

Tasting Note: Deep straw in colour with good acidity, a medium intense nose & a long length on the finish. This wine features: Gooseberry, fresh cut grass, lemon-lime custard, grapefruit, passionfruit & chalk.     

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Fermented in both stainless steel and French oak barrels

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 3-4 years on its own or pair it with Green Papaya Salad with Grilled Shrimp

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: April 9, 2021

GLORIA FERRER BLANC DE NOIRS ROSÉ NV, Méthode Traditionnelle, Carneros, California, United States of America

13 Saturday Mar 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Recommended, Sparkling Wine

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$34.95
Grape: Pinot Noir
Category: Sparkling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: United States of America
Region: Carneros, California
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Gloria Ferrer
Alcohol:  12.5% Alcohol/Vol.

Full body, full of flavour, good value. Score: 90/100

Tasting Note: Rose gold in colour with fine mousse, good acidity, a mild intense nose & a long length on the finish. This wine features: Light yeast, brioche, black cherry, strawberry, lemon meringue, red apples, cola & vanilla.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Currently, the LCBO has the regular Brut Blanc de Noir with the SKU number listed below.

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 5-7 years on its own or pair it with Spiced Pork Chops within Cherry Thyme pan sauce.

My Opinion: Recommended

Tasted: March 12, 2021 (Happy Birthday to me!)

LCBO: 925735

DOMAINE STE. MICHELLE BRUT SPARKLING WINE NV, Méthode Classique, Columbia Valley, Washington State, United States of America

12 Friday Mar 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Best Buys, Recommended, Sparkling Wine

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$19.95
Grape: Chardonnay, Pinot Noir, Pinot Meunier
Category: Sparkling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: United States of America
Region: Columbia Valley, Washington State
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Domaine Ste. Michelle
Alcohol:  11.5% Alcohol/Vol.

Full body where its dryness is in between bone dry & sweat, so right down the middle. Very easy drinking & full of flavour. Score: 89/100

Tasting Note: Light gold in colour with fine mousse, good acidity, a medium intense+ nose & an average length on the finish. This wine features: Light yeast, brioche, pear, green apple, lemon & Easter Lily on the nose.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Outside Cava’s that are also traditional method that are mostly priced under $20, it’s rare to see in an Ontario sparkling wine made the same way being under $20.

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 5-7 years on its own or pair it with calamari.

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: March 11, 2021

LCBO: 557637

FRANSCHHOEK CELLAR, THE CHURCHYARD, CABERNET SAUVIGNON 2018, Franschhoek, South Africa

08 Monday Mar 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Recommended, Red Wines

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$14.95
Grape: Cabernet Sauvignon
Category: Red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: South Africa
Region: Franschhoek
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Franschhoek Cellar
Alcohol:  14.0% Alcohol/Vol.

An intense wine with lots of blackcurrants. Score: 86/100

Tasting Note: Dark ruby in colour with good acidity, dry tannin, a medium+ intense nose & a long length on the finish. This wine features: Blackcurrants, plum, blackberry, black truffle, leather, pencil shavings & turmeric.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Decanting this wine will expose more than just blackcurrants.

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 5-7 years on its own or pair it with Pork Medallions with Apples, Blackcurrants and crispy Sage

My Opinion: Recommended

Tasted: March 7, 2021

LCBO: 634667

NIAGARA COLLEGE TEACHING WINERY BARREL FERMENTED BALANCE CHARDONNAY 2015, VQA St. David’s Bench, Niagara Region, Ontario, Canada

06 Saturday Mar 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Best Buys, Canadian Wines, Niagara College Teaching Winery, Recommended, White Wines, Winery Review Series

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$18.95
Grape: Chardonnay
Category: White Wine
Location: Winery
Country: Canada
Region: St. David’s Bench, Niagara Region, Ontario
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Niagara College Teaching Winery
Alcohol:  12.0% Alcohol/Vol.

This Balance Chard is nicely balanced between the citric fruit, the light oak notes & the graceful creaminess but still refreshing without being overtly crisp. 89/100

Tasting Note: Light gold in colour with good acidity, a medium+ intense nose & a good length on the finish. This wine features: lemon, green apple, pear, honeydew melon, vanilla & coconut.    

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: Don’t over chill this wine, as you will lose its complexity

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 3-4 years on its own or pair it with North Atlantic lobster wrapped in egg pasta with sauteed bacon in a beurre blanc sauce.

My Opinion: Recommended

Best Buy

Tasted: March 5, 2021

BOLLATO DI GUARINI NEGROAMARO PRIMITIVO 2018, IGP Puglia, Italy

02 Tuesday Mar 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Recommended, Red Wines

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$17.00
Grape: Negroamaro & Primitivo
Category: Red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: Italy
Region: Puglia
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Losito e Guarini
Alcohol:  14.0% Alcohol/Vol.

A complex wine but the correct glassware will make a huge difference between pleasant drinking or overtly sweet. Smaller glassware for Sangiovese will be the best choice. 88/100

Tasting Note: Dark ruby in colour with good acidity, a medium+ intense nose, soft tannin & a good length on the finish. This wine features: Plum, Bing cherries, ripe tamarind, blueberry, blueberry, aged balsamic, leather, thyme, tobacco, pepper, figs & violets on the nose.   

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: 1. I got this wine as I love the rum style bottle, but it pours poorly do to the large lip. 2. Besides the correct stemware, serve this wine between 16-18C.

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 4-6 years on its own or pair it with Wild Boar Ribs with Fig BBQ Sauce.

My Opinion: Recommended

Tasted: March 1, 2021

LCBO: 17884

DANDELION VINEYARDS TWILIGHT OF ADELAIDE HILLS CHARDONNAY 2018, Adelaide Hills, New Zealand

27 Saturday Feb 2021

Posted by Twilight Wines in Recommended, White Wines

≈ Leave a comment


Cost: $20.95
Grape: Chardonnay
Category: White Wine
Location: LCBO Vintages
Country: Australia
Region: Adelaide Hills
Format: 750 mL
Producer: Dandelion Vineyards
Alcohol:  12.5% Alcohol/Vol.

Chablis in style, this wine has some oak influence & it’s bone dry, crisp & clean. Score: 88/100

Tasting Note: Light bright gold with a green tinge in colour with good acidity, a medium intense nose & a long length on the finish. This wine features: lemon, green apples, pear, peach & ginger.

Negatives: None

Interesting Point: The grapes were picked during twilight time, ergo the name, & speaking of the name, how could I not get it?!

Pairings: Drink this now or in the next 5-7 of years on its own or pair it with herb & lemon scallops on a bed of Angel Hair.

My Opinion: Recommended

Tasted: February 27, 2021

LCBO: 368274
